How to setup Brevent app on your device
To use Brevent, you’ll need to enable Developer Options on your device:
- Turn on Wifi
- Go to Brevent App
- Tab on Developer Option
- Tap on
- Go to Settings > About Phone.
- Tap Build Number seven times to unlock Developer Options.
- Navigate to Settings > Developer Options and enable USB Debugging.
- Enable Wireless debugging from Developer Option.
- Then again goto the brevent app and tap on wireless
debugging port. - Split Screen 1.Developer Option and 2.Brevent app
- Goto Wireless debugging and tap on Pair device with pairing code from Developer Option..
- Copy the wifi paired code.
- Put the wireless pairing code in Brevent app and tap on wireless pair

Why Avoid Rooting?
Rooting your phone lets you use special tools for better gaming. But it can break your warranty, make your phone less secure, and cause permanent damage. For most players, safer, non-root ways to boost performance are just as good. Let’s see how to get:
